New Year's Eve was an awesome night for music on TV, with everyone from Lil Wayne and Nicki Minaj to My Chemical Romance and NKOTBSB helping fans in Times Square -- and across the country -- rock in 2011. Don't worry if you were out partying (or passed out before the ball dropped) and missed some of the music. Here's our round-up of the 10 best performances from last night's broadcasts.

 

MORE: Justin Bieber, Paramore & More Reveal 2011 Plans

 

 

Lil Wayne "6 Foot 7 Foot" (New Year's Eve with Carson Daly)

 

 

Ke$ha "Tik Tok" (Dick Clark's New Year's Rockin' Eve)


 

 

My Chemical Romance "Na Na Na Na" (New Year's Eve with Carson Daly)

 


Jennifer Hudson "Feelin' Good" (Dick Clark's New Year's Rockin' Eve)

 

 

Avril Lavinge "What the Hell' (Dick Clark's New Year's Rockin' Eve)
